Lonsdale Way is in Oakham and in Rutland district. LE15 6LP is located in the Oakham North West electoral ward, within the English Parliamentary constituency of Rutland and Melton. This postcode has been in use since 1980-01-01.

In the UK, the overall gender distribution is approximately 49% male and 51% female. However, the area surrounding LE15 6LP, has a female population slightly higher than UK average, with 52.8% of residents being female. Several factors can contribute to this. Women generally live longer than men, resulting in a higher proportion of women in neighborhoods with significant elderly populations. Typically, as people grow older, they tend to relocate from city center addresses to suburban areas, smaller towns, and rural locations. Consequently, these areas often have a higher number of females. A higher female population can also be found in areas with industries that employ more women, such as healthcare, education, and retail.
| 2011 | 2021 | 10y change (pp) | UK Average | postcode vs UK (pp) | |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Female | 49.8% | 52.8% | 3.0% | 51.0% | 1.8% |
| Male | 50.2% | 47.2% | -3.0% | 49.0% | -1.8% |

Over the last 12 months, the overall crime rate around Lonsdale Way was 3.2 per 1,000 residents, which is 95.0% lower than the Barleythorpe average. The most reported crime type was Violence and sexual offences.
Lonsdale Way has the lowest crime rate of 26 local areas in Barleythorpe and the lowest crime rate of 99 local areas in Rutland .
Violent and sexual offences accounted for around 3.2 crimes per 1,000 residents and have remained broadly unchanged year on year. Over the last decade, overall crime has fallen by about -36.0%.

LE15 6LP area has a low unemployment rate. According to Census 2021, 2% residents of this area were unemployed, while the average in the UK was 4.83%. A low level of unemployment in an area indicates a strong job market, where most people who are seeking work can find employment. This generally reflects a healthy economy in the area.
